How Esports Match Formats and Data Shape Smarter Viewing in 2026

Competitive gaming has developed far beyond casual online play. Major esports now operate through professional leagues, international tournaments, structured qualification systems and detailed competitive rulebooks. Viewers can follow team form, roster changes, map selections, game patches and live statistics in much the same way that traditional sports audiences study line-ups, tactics and recent results.

However, esports cannot be understood by looking at a team name or final score alone. A best-of-one group match is different from a best-of-five final. A strong Counter-Strike 2 team may still struggle on a particular map, while a League of Legends roster can perform very differently after a major patch changes the competitive meta. Learning how these factors interact makes esports more enjoyable and helps viewers interpret match information with greater discipline.

Match Format Changes the Competitive Picture

One of the first details to check is the series format. Esports tournaments commonly use best-of-one, best-of-three and best-of-five matches. Each format places different demands on the participating teams.

Best-of-One Matches

A best-of-one match leaves little room for recovery. One weak draft, unsuccessful strategy or early mechanical mistake can determine the entire result. Underdogs may have a better opportunity to create an upset because the stronger team has less time to adapt. Viewers should therefore be careful when treating a single best-of-one result as proof of long-term superiority.

Best-of-Three Series

Best-of-three competition rewards preparation and flexibility. Teams can adjust their approach after the opening map or game, while coaching decisions become more visible. A roster with a deeper map pool or wider range of strategic options often gains an advantage as the series develops.

Best-of-Five Finals

Long finals test endurance, communication and adaptation. Teams must maintain concentration across several hours, respond to tactical changes and manage the pressure of elimination. Historical head-to-head results can provide useful context, but they should not replace an assessment of current roster strength, tournament form and game conditions.

Every Esports Title Requires Different Analysis

The word “esports” covers many different competitive systems. The information that matters in one game may be far less important in another. A useful analysis begins by understanding the specific title being played.

League of Legends

League of Legends analysis often focuses on drafting, champion flexibility, objective control and the ability to convert early advantages. A team may build a lead through lane pressure but still lose if it cannot control major objectives or coordinate effectively during later team fights. Patch changes are especially important because they can strengthen particular champions, items and strategies.

Dota 2

Dota 2 has a large hero pool and complex drafting phase. Viewers should consider hero combinations, counter-picks, farming priorities and the timing of important item purchases. Tournament experience also matters because long Dota 2 series can require repeated strategic adjustments.

Counter-Strike 2

Map selection is central to Counter-Strike 2. A team with an impressive overall record may be vulnerable on a map it rarely plays. The veto process, recent map statistics, pistol-round performance and the strength of each side on attack and defence all provide more context than a simple win-loss table.

Valorant

Valorant combines mechanical skill with agent composition, utility timing and map-specific execution. Roster changes can have a particularly large effect because communication and role balance are essential. Recent results should be examined alongside the quality of opposition and the maps played.

Mobile Legends: Bang Bang

Mobile Legends has become a major competitive title across Southeast Asia. Draft priority, objective timing, rotation speed and regional play style can influence a match. International tournaments are particularly interesting because teams from different regions may approach the same competitive patch in different ways.

Roster News and Coaching Changes Matter

Team statistics can quickly become outdated after a roster change. Replacing one player may affect communication, leadership, drafting and role distribution. Even when the incoming player has strong individual statistics, the team may need time to develop coordination.

Coaching changes can be equally important. A new coach may introduce different map priorities, preparation routines or drafting ideas. Before relying on historical results, viewers should confirm whether the same players and coaching staff produced them.

Game Patches Can Reset Previous Expectations

Traditional sports rules normally remain stable throughout a season. Esports titles can change much faster. Developers regularly update characters, maps, weapons, items and competitive systems. A strategy that dominated one tournament may become less effective after the next patch.

Responsible analysis therefore checks the tournament patch and compares it with the versions used in earlier matches. Statistics collected under an older competitive environment should not automatically be applied to a new one. Teams that adapt quickly may temporarily outperform opponents with stronger long-term records.

Live Statistics Need Context

Live scoreboards can show kills, gold differences, objectives, round results and other performance data. These numbers are useful, but they are not guarantees. A League of Legends team can lead in kills while losing control of the map. A Counter-Strike 2 roster can win several rounds but still face a difficult economy. Statistics must be interpreted within the rules and strategic structure of the game.

A Practical Esports Research Checklist

Before forming an opinion about an upcoming match, viewers can use the following checklist:

  • Confirm whether the match is best-of-one, best-of-three or best-of-five.
  • Check the tournament stage and whether elimination is involved.
  • Review current rosters, substitutes and coaching changes.
  • Identify the game patch being used.
  • Study map pools, drafting tendencies and recent opponents.
  • Separate online results from offline tournament performance.
  • Use official sources to verify schedules and rule changes.
  • Avoid treating statistics, odds or predictions as guaranteed outcomes.
